What is Latch Bio?
Latch Bio is at the forefront of the biocomputing revolution, developing essential data infrastructure for the scientific community. Its cloud-based platform empowers scientists to effortlessly store, transform, and visualize biological data through any web browser. This innovative approach democratizes access to popular bioinformatics pipelines and data visualization tools, enabling global researchers to accelerate discovery and innovation without requiring extensive coding expertise. The company's mission is to build and disseminate the foundational data infrastructure necessary for the next wave of biological advancements.
How much funding has Latch Bio raised?
Latch Bio has raised a total of $33M across 2 funding rounds:
Angel/Seed
$5M
Series A
$28M
Angel/Seed (2021): $5M with participation from Haystack, General Catalyst, and Lux Capital
Series A (2022): $28M led by Lux Capital, Coatue, Haystack, Fifty Years, Caffeinated Capital, and Hummingbird Ventures
